Clinically relevant frontal sinus anatomy and physiology.
R B McLaughlin1, R M Rehl, D C Lanza
1Director of Aesthetic Surgery Services, Kaiser Permanente Hospital System, Sacramento, California, USA.
Endoscopic sinus surgery has advanced frontal sinus disease management, requiring otolaryngologists to master complex anatomy. Understanding this anatomy is key to effectively treating frontal sinus disease.

Cranial Bones: Superior and Posterior View
The frontal bone is the single bone that forms the forehead. At its anterior midline, between the eyebrows, there is a slight depression called the glabella. The frontal bone also forms the supraorbital margin of the orbit. Near the middle of this margin is the supraorbital foramen, the opening that provides passage for a sensory nerve to the forehead. Cranial Bones: Lateral View
The temporal bone forms the lower lateral side of the skull. The temporal bone is subdivided into several regions. The flattened upper portion is the squamous portion of the temporal bone. Below this area and projecting anteriorly is the zygomatic process of the temporal bone, which forms the posterior portion of the zygomatic arch.
